Insurer companies offering special enrollment period for same sex couples

Most Wisconsin insurers are joining the Department of Employee Trust Funds and offering a special enrollment period for same-sex couples who married in Wisconsin or other states earlier this year and have missed the 30-day window usually applied to "life-changing" events. (WHN 10/28)

CMS report: Wisconsin's Medicaid program growing at slower rate than other non-expansion states

"Wisconsin's Medicaid program is growing at a slower rate than most other states that did not accept federal health reform law dollars to expand Medicaid, and well below the pace of expansion states, according to a recent report from the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services." (WHN, 10/27)

ProHealth joins Anthem's Blue Priority network

"ProHealth Care will join Anthem Blue Cross and Blue Shield's Blue Priority network Dec. 1. The network includes the six other members of a statewide provider partnership ProHealth joined earlier this month, as well as the Children's Hospital System in Milwaukee and Meriter-UnityPoint Health in Madison." (WHN, 10/27)

State launches Ebola information line

"The Department of Health Services launched a toll free line Friday for questions about the Ebola virus. The number is 1-844-684-1064. Calls are free, confidential and multilingual." (WHN, 10/27)
